Willie Mullins relies on four horses in the entries for the Crabbie's Grand National at Aintree on Saturday.

The Closutton handler is going all out to wrest the UK trainers' title and pins his hopes of winning the National a second time after Hedgehunter in 2005 with On His Own, Sir Des Champs, Boston Bob and Ballycasey.

However, the shortest-priced Irish horse in the ante-post markets is Gordon Elliott's Cause Of Causes, while last year's Midlands National hero Goonyella and Tony Martin's Gallant Oscar are also shorter in the betting than Mullins' apparent main hope Boston Bob.

Other Irish hopes include Pat Fahy's Cheltenham fourth Morning Assembly and Elliott's Ucello Conti, who finished third in the Thyestes last time.
